In any industrial or manufacturing facility, unseen problems can cause sudden failures, production losses, or even fires. That’s where Thermography comes in.

 
This advanced thermal imaging technique helps detect early signs of faults by identifying abnormal heat patterns in equipment, electrical systems, and building structures.

Thermography is Used to Detect:

1️⃣ Leaks

Thermal imaging identifies unusual temperature changes—whether hot or cold—that signal escaping fluids, gases, or air. This makes it easy to locate hidden leaks in pipelines, steam lines, HVAC systems, and refrigeration units without any surface damage.

2️⃣ Defects

Infrared scans uncover hidden defects such as cracks, voids, poor welds, and structural weaknesses. Both heat loss and cold infiltration patterns can reveal issues early, helping prevent major equipment failures and production delays.

3️⃣ Insulation Failures

Thermal imaging pinpoints areas where insulation is compromised—whether it's heat escaping from ovens or cold air leaking from freezers. This allows for targeted repairs to improve energy efficiency and thermal control.

4️⃣ Fire and Freeze Risk Prevention

Thermography detects overheating components like wires and electrical panels, reducing fire risks. It also identifies cold spots that could lead to freezing in pipelines or sensitive systems, helping to prevent weather-related damages.

5️⃣ Hotspots and Coldspots Detection

Thermal inspections reveal abnormal hot or cold areas in motors, transformers, bearings, refrigeration systems, and building envelopes. These signs often indicate mechanical stress, wear, overloading, or inefficiencies that require timely intervention.
